PENGARUH AKTIVITAS ANTROPOGENIK DI SUNGAI CILIWUNG TERHADAP KOMUNITAS LARVA TRICHOPTERA (Effect of Anthropogenic Activities on Trichoptera Larvae Community in Ciliwung River) Jojok Sudarso; Yusli Wardiatno; Daniel Djoko Setiyanto; Woro Anggraitoningsih
Jurnal Manusia dan Lingkungan Vol 20, No 1 (2013): Maret

ABSTRAKSungai Ciliwung merupakan salah satu sungai besar di Propinsi Jawa Barat yang sekarang telah mengalami pencemaran organik dan kontaminasi oleh logam merkuri. Adanya pencemaran di Sungai Ciliwung dikhawatirkan dapat mengganggu keseimbangan ekologi dari larva serangga Trichoptera. Oleh sebab itu tujuan dari penelitian ini adalah mengungkap pengaruh aktivitas antropogenik pada Sungai Ciliwung terhadap komunitas larva Trichoptera. Pengambilan larva dilakukan dengan menggunakan jala surber dengan limakali ulangan setiap lokasi. Analisis korelasi pearson-product moment menunjukkan adanya korelasi yang kuat (r > 0,5) antara metrik biologi jumlah taksa, jumlah skor Stream Invertebrate Grade Number-Average level SIGNAL, % kelimpahan dominansi 3, dan indeks SIGNAL dengan variabel lingkungan: suhu air, coarse particulate organic matter (CPOM), kandungan oksigen terlarut (DO), konduktivitas, total padatan tersuspensi (TDS), C dan N dalam partikulat, nitrat, amonium, ortofosfat, COD, logam merkuri di air dan sedimen, indeks habitat, distribusi partikel, turbiditas, indeks kimia Kirchoff, dan indeks pencemaran logam merkuri di sedimen. Larva Trichoptera Helicopsyche, Apsilochorema, Caenota, Ulmerochorema, Chimarra, Antipodoecia, Diplectrona, Anisocentropus, Lepidostoma, Genus Hel.C cenderung dicirikan oleh tingkat pencemaran organik yang rendah, tingginya komposisi % kerikil dan CPOM, dan kondisi habitat yang minim mengalami gangguan. The contamination may disrupt the ecological balance of Trichoptera insect larvae. Therefore, the aim of this study is to reveal the influence of anthropogenic activities occurring in the Ciliwung River on Trichoptera larvae community. Larvae collection was conducted using surber with five replications per location. Pearson-product moment correlation analysis showed a strong correlation (r> 0.5) between the number of taxa biological metrics, the number of scores Stream Invertebrate Grade Number-Average ( SIGNAL), and % abundance of three dominance Trichoptera larvae with environmental variables, i.e.water temperature, coarse particulate organic matter (CPOM), dissolved oxygen (DO), conductivity, total suspended solids (TDS), C and N in the seston, nitrate, ammonium, orthophosphoric, chemical oxygen demand (COD), metallic mercury in water, sediment, habitat index, distribution of particles, turbidity, chemical Kirchoff index, and index mercury pollution in sediments. Larvae of Trichoptera Helicopsyche, Apsilochorema, Caenota, Ulmerochorema, Chimarra, Antipodoecia, Diplectrona, Anisocentropus, Lepidostoma, and Genus Hel.C tend to be characterized by low organic pollution,% gravel, CPOM, and minimum disruption habitat conditions. While Glososomatidae Genus 1, Cheumatopsyche, Setodes, and Tinodes are relatively more tolerant to organic pollutant, low CPOM, high turbidity, the concentration of mercury in sediment, TDS, and % clay.
